Transaction acaca885401355871f3c3c959357f1a4fd14d8989c20a71e46f2a2af30f70016
1 Input
1 Output
-
acaca885401355871f3c3c959357f1a4fd14d8989c20a71e46f2a2af30f70016:0
- value
- 659102707
- script pubkey
- OP_0 OP_PUSHBYTES_20 52c982baa225c984a21c4d4e8582205a8acaf33f
- address
- bc1q2tyc9w4zyhycfgsuf48gtq3qt29v4uelv2h4k0